Frequently Asked Questions about Corporate Roberts Apartments

What is the Cheapest Corporate apartment in Roberts?

Currently the most affordable Corporate Apartment in Roberts is at Adams Street Apartments - No Fee, Short Term listed at $1,175.

How much is the average rent for a Corporate Roberts Apartment?

The average rent for a Corporate Apartment in Roberts is $3,426.

What is the largest Corporate Roberts Apartment for rent?

Today's Corporate apartment with the most square footage in Roberts is a 1,932 square feet unit starting from $2,850 at Cronin's Landing.

What is the average size for Roberts Corporate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Corporate rental in Roberts is currently at 613 sq ft.
